Antique French whitework collar hand embroidered early 1800s gorgeous! Phenomenal French whitework collar HAND embroidered circa very early 1800s. This cream collar measures 13.5 inches at the top and is 4 inches deep, the fabric is a very fine hand woven cotton, the design elements are exquisite with cornucopias of dainty flowers and what look like wings, the handwork is astonishingly fine, this is some of the nicest French whitework I have seen in design and execution, done by and extremely talented needle woman, each little section of needle lace filling stitches are little worlds of their own, the stitches so small and fine you need 10x magnification to see them (I have my pinky finger in one of the pics to give an idea of how very fine the lace is)! There are some separations at the very top in the fabric, the rest of the lace is in excellent condition, this would frame beautifully...a little masterpiece! You just don't see pieces like this much.
